Feeling good inside matters as much as staying fit on the outside. Emotional wellbeing is about how you manage feelings, cope with stress and stay positive. It isn’t a fancy concept – it’s the everyday ability to bounce back from setbacks, keep a calm mind, and enjoy life’s small moments.
